Material
Grade and Strength
As to range of strength, Byard spiral weld pipe mills will manufacture
in conformance to JIS G3444 (Carbon Steel Pipe for General Structural
Purposes), G3457 (Are Welded Carbon Steel Pipe for General Piping)
and the API standards, ranging from 5LS Gr. B (minimum yield strength
of 24kg/mm2) to X-70 (minimum yield strength of 49 kg/mm2). Byard
mills will also manufacture spiral-welded pipe for special purposes,
such as high strength pipe for low temperature service, pipe for
transmission of powders and slurry and abrasion-resistant pipe for
subsea dredging.

Transmission
Use
Pipe manufactured from our SAW spiral mills may be used for the
transmission of natural gas and oil, low and medium pressure city
gas mains, water supply mains and steam or gas piping in chemical
plants and petroleum refineries.
The standards applicable to spiral weided pipe for these piping
sevices include:
| API
5LS |
Spiral
Weld Line Pipe |
| ASTM
A139 |
Electric
Fusion (Are) Welded Steel Pipe |
| ASTM
A155 |
Electric
Fusion Welded Steel Pipe for High Temperature Service |
| AWWAC202 |
Mill
Type Steel Water Pipe |
| DIN
17172 |
Steel
Pipe for Pipelines for the Transport of Combustible Fluids and
Gases, Technical Conditions of Delivery. |
| DIN
1626 |
Welded
Steel Pipes in Unalloyed and Low Alloyed Steels for Supply Purpose
Process Plant and Tanks. |
| JIS
G3457 |
Are
Welded Carbon Steel Pipe for General Piping. |
| BS
4360 |
General
Steel Piping. |
Structural
Use
High strength steel pipe of heavy wall thickness for structural
purpose is manufactured on our SAW spiral mill. Spiral welded pipe
is used in the largest quantities for such structural purposes,
because of the following characteristics:
- Dimensional
accuracy, such as in roundness and straightness, is good.
- Non standard
sizes (outside diameter, wall thickness etc) are available.
- Any desired
length is available. Long lengths (up to 40 metres long) spiral
welded pipe can be manufactured without jointing.
